All audio log locations in Fortnite Chapter 7 Season 4

Chapter 7 Season 4 is building its story the old-fashioned way: scatter collectibles across the map, drop vague hints about what's coming, and let players piece it together one audio log at a time. Fortnite has been releasing these logs in batches throughout the season, and as of this week, five are live and waiting to be found.

The key here is that not all of these logs come with map pins. Some do, some don't, and the ones without markers are easy to walk straight past if you don't know what you're looking for. The telltale sign is a diamond with an exclamation point appearing on your screen when you get close enough.

The first three logs dropped in late August

The opening batch of three audio logs went live on August 20, and they're spread across fairly distinct areas of the map.

The first is tucked inside a cave just southwest of the override console near Latte Landing. Head south from the console and look for the cave entrance to the west of the large cable coming out of the ground. There's also a road to the north or east that leads into the mountain, with a zipline that takes you up into the cave.

The second sits on top of a snowy mountain north of Reality's Reign, right beside a tree and near some large ice formations. Hard to miss once you're up there, but getting elevation in that area takes a moment.

The third is on top of the large rock formation in the northeast corner of Green Hill Zone. This one is partially hidden by grass, so watch for that exclamation point indicator rather than trying to spot the log itself.

Two more logs arrived this week

The second batch dropped on September 3, adding two more logs to the hunt. Both are in the southern half of the map, clustered near Heatwave Harbor.

The first is just north of the Sandy Buttes Hotel, which sits in the middle of the left side of Heatwave Harbor. Jump the tall hedge fence and the log is right beside the building.

The second is west of a red barn sitting directly between Stone Sanctum, Green Hill Zone, and Heatwave Harbor. Follow the road northwest out of Heatwave Harbor and you'll run into it. The log is next to the large tree outside the barn, not inside.

What the logs are actually for

These aren't just collectibles for the sake of it. Audio logs are story quest items that feed into the larger Chapter 7 Season 4 narrative, and each one unlocks a piece of context about what's unfolding on the island. Epic has been using this format across recent seasons to drip-feed lore between major story events, and if you've been following the Chapter 7 Season 3 audio log guide or the Override story audio logs, you'll know the pattern by now: more batches are coming as the season progresses.
